We are seeking Release Train Engineers to join our Enterprise Solutions and Technology business area.
As a Release Train Engineer (EL 2), you'll facilitate the Agile Release Train (ART) and Solution Train processes and execution respectively, while closely partnering with the Product Manager, Business areas and IT Delivery owners.
You will align to program level cadence and drive program level ceremonies (Program Increment planning, product management groups, scrum of scrums, release train retrospectives) and work with other program leaders to drive the definition and refinement of the program backlog. You'll coordinate and facilitate strategic decision making to achieve delivery outcomes and build efficiency and effectiveness in how we train and utilise our workforce. You'll escalate impediments, manage risk, help ensure value delivery, and help drive improvement.
In these roles, you will provide leadership, direction, and mentoring to deliver on government and corporate priorities to the Australian community. You'll participate in the Lean-Agile transformation, coach leaders, teams, and Scrum Masters in the new processes and mindsets, by assisting the configuration of SAFe to the agency's needs, standardising and documenting practices.
